New Cop In The Shield Comes From A Land Down Under After writers killed off Detective Lemonhead Lemansky from Mackey’s strike team in FX’s ‘The Shield’, writers clearly felt a hunky Aussie would be the perfect fit to fill the void left by Lemansky. Australian actor Alex O’Loughlin will be the newest member of the cast, playing Kevin Hiatt, the new cop on the block.

There isn’t much to tell about O’Loughlin. Aside from being decidedly good looking (sorry, but its true) and Australian, he’s played a cop before in the film Man-Thing and on the other side of the coin, he played a suspect in the film Feed. Did I mention he’s good looking?

The show ‘The Shield’, while not being huge on the ratings-radar, has always been spoken highly of by loyal fans. The show’s been around for five seasons and it’s headed into a sixth so they must be doing something right.
